Frequently Asked Questions + Help

What is the research schedule? How do I meet with my advisor?
The program lasts 8 weeks. Further details are to be worked out with your advisor. You are required to complete 20 hours per week.

Where do I work?
This should be discussed with your advisor and program staff. You are required to participate in person in the research presentations as scheduled.

What is expected of a high school summer scholar?
See the section of this website on Guidelines + Expectations.

I'm a high school senior. Can I still apply?
Only juniors prior to the summer are eligible for this program at the present time.  Juniors must attend The Preuss School UCSD, Gompers Preparatory Academy or Lincoln High School.  Check back in early 2015 for eligibility rules for the next class of summer scholars as this requirement may change.

Are international students accepted?
At present, only students attending UC San Diego Preuss School, Gompers Preparatory, and Lincoln High School are eligible to apply, but these restrictions may change for the summer 2015 program.

Are late applications accepted?
Late applications are usually not accepted unless there are extenuating circumstances that prevent submission of the application before the deadline. Moreover, applications received before the deadlines are given first priority.  The deadline to apply for the 2014 Summer Scholars Program is April 21, 2014 before 5pm PST.

How do I find an advisor?
Students are not required to find an advisor. The program will match high school students with faculty advisors and Qualcomm Institute undergraduate summer scholars, taking into account faculty needs and the student’s background and essay.

How do I submit a letter of recommendation from my high school advisor?
Upon applying to be a summer scholar, you will be asked to enter your advisor's full name and email address. Once you have submitted your application, your advisor will be notified through email with instructions on how to upload the recommendation letter. Please keep in mind that your advisor MUST complete this form by the designated date (before 5pm PST on April 21, 2014). Therefore, it is recommended that you submit your application well before the deadline to give your advisor time to complete his/her portion.

What's the competition like?
This is the second year of the program and we hope to match one high school student to work with each undergraduate scholar (usually between 25 and 30 Calit2 Scholars).

Is there an interview?
Yes.  Once you submit your application, it will be under review and you will be notified by the end of May 2014 of whether you will be granted an interview to determine placement in the program.
